CLEVELAND (WJW) — In the midst of a disappointing 2025 season, the Cleveland Guardians have announced what to look forward to in the year ahead.

Tuesday, the team released its schedule for the 2026 season, meaning you can start making your home opener plans today. For that game, which ends up being a city-wide holiday every year, the Guards are taking on the Chicago Cubs on April 3. It is not yet clear if it will be snowing on that day.
